MarkDown 入门学习笔记

原文地址简书如何使用MarkDown

注意

我会用 语法:效果: 的方式呈现出来


1. 标题

语法:

#我是一级标题
##我是二级标题
###我是三级标题
######我是六级标题
#######最大六个

效果:

我是一级标题

我是二级标题

我是三级标题

我是六级标题

<br >


2. 强调

语法:

*写代码是一门艺术*
_写代码是一门艺术_

**写代码是一门艺术**
__写代码是一门艺术__

效果:

写代码是一门艺术

写代码是一门艺术

写代码是一门艺术

写代码是一门艺术


3. 强制换行

语法:

</br>    (“/br”是连写的)
<br />   (“br /”之间有一个空格)

效果:
1
</br>
2

<br />
3



5. 列表

无序列表

语法:

* 目录一 无序列表   `* + 空格键`
* 目录二 无序列表
 * 目录二的子目录一        无序列表 `TAB + * + 空格键`
 * 目录二的子目录二

效果:

  • 目录一 无序列表 * + 空格键
  • 目录二 无序列表
  • 目录二的子目录一 无序列表 TAB + * + 空格键
  • 目录二的子目录二

有序列表

语法:

1. 目录一 有序列表 `数字 + . + 空格键`
2. 目录二 
3. 目录三 
 1. 项目三的子项目一 有序列表 `TAB + 数字 + . + 空格键`
 2. 项目三的子项目二
  1. 目录一 有序列表 数字 + . + 空格键
  2. 目录二
  3. 目录三
  4. 目录三的子目录一 有序列表 TAB + 数字 + . + 空格键
  5. 目录三的子目录二

6. 图片

语法:

![嗨](https://ss0.bdstatic.com/94oJfD_bAAcT8t7mm9GUKT-xh_/timg?image&quality=100&size=b4000_4000&sec=1533384295&di=b585d80f4abb59053720a331b1f50bbd&src=http://hbimg.b0.upaiyun.com/225a5f3f75d1d4c59532704782eebd25d323fd801e57a-VlY5c4_fw658)

格式: ![嗨](https://ss0.bdstatic.com/94oJfD_bAAcT8t7mm9GUKT-xh_/timg?image&quality=100&size=b4000_4000&sec=1533384295&di=b585d80f4abb59053720a331b1f50bbd&src=http://hbimg.b0.upaiyun.com/225a5f3f75d1d4c59532704782eebd25d323fd801e57a-VlY5c4_fw658)

![]()

效果:
[图片上传失败...(image-f81199-1533384242542)]

如果是本地图片直接拖到编辑区域,简书会自动给你添加.

当然你也可以用图床,这里推荐围脖图床修复计划CloudApp 的服务,生成URL地址即可。


7. 链接

语法:

邮箱       <youname@163.com>
[简书] (//www.greatytc.com)
自动生成连接  <//www.greatytc.com>

效果:

Email 连接: youname@163.com
连接·简书·网站
自动生成连接像: //www.greatytc.com 这样


8. 行内代码

语法:

像这样即可:`<addr>` `code`

效果:

像这样即可:<addr> code


9. 多行或者一段代码

语法:

```js
//MARK: - UIButton
- (void)clickDeleteBtn:(UIButton*)btn
{
    if (self.deleBtnBlock)
        self.deleBtnBlock();
}
```

效果:

//MARK: - UIButton
- (void)clickDeleteBtn:(UIButton*)btn
{
    if (self.deleBtnBlock)
        self.deleBtnBlock();
}
    ```
- - -
#10. 区块引用
语法:

她说:
写代码是一门艺术.
写代码是一门艺术..

效果:

>她说:
写代码是一门艺术.
写代码是一门艺术..
  
- - -
#11. 表格

语法:

第一格表头 第二格表头
内容单元格 第一列第一格 内容单元格第二列第一格
内容单元格 第一列第二格 多加文字 内容单元格第二列第二格

效果:

第一格表头 | 第二格表头
--------- | -------------
内容单元格 第一列第一格 | 内容单元格第二列第一格
内容单元格 第一列第二格 多加文字 | 内容单元格第二列第二格

- - -
#12. 删除线
语法:

加删除线像这样用: 写代码是一门艺术


效果:

加删除线像这样用: ~~写代码是一门艺术~~

- - -
#13. 分割线

语法:

```js

以下三种方式都可以生成分隔线:

 ***

 *****

 - - -

效果:




最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 173,124评论 25 708
  • 立夏是夏季的第一个节气,是告诉我们这些有趣的人类,需要告别春天、好好迎战酷暑了。 南昌的夏,有些惨烈,对于我这种易...
    7咯柒阅读 222评论 0 0
  • 小时候,父母在保护我们,让我们在这个复杂社会上不被欺骗,用他们的真心来温暖我们不被伤害。 最爱我们,最无私关心我们...
    新河岸阅读 542评论 0 0
  • 不知不觉发现自己 像只小兽被困在了生活里 我努力的想要逃离 远离这人世间的各种混乱 后来发现这是命运 颠沛流离或历...
    上官楠阅读 314评论 2 4
  • 从你身旁走过,却发现我们像两条平行线,永远没有交点
    阿牛丶阅读 148评论 0 0